    I have never had any luck with contest. At one time I gave away a $150 prize for a single article - and only got 2 entries.

    A few months later I tried having another contest, and had the same results, only 2 or 3 people entered.

    My forum is getting well over 1,000,000 page views a month, around 600 members visiting every 24 hours and around 1,600+ members visiting monthly - and I still can not get people to enter a contest. And you have 48 registered users - do not expect any kind of results from a contest.

    Instead of holding contest, I do random drawings at the end of the month. My daughter or wife will pick a name from the list of active members - then that person gets a gift worth about $20.

    At the end of every month I post an end of the month report. I will post how many post we got, how many new members, how many new threads and in that this report I will post the winner of the monthly random prize. This is a whole lot less stressful on me. And since the drawing is random, anyone can win.

    If the winner is outside the US, I give them a couple of months in the paid membership group.

    Overall, contest fail to give the results that forum owners hope for and are really a waste of time. If you want to give something away, give a random prize away to a random active member. This will give people a reason to visit your forum on a regular basis. If they visit, they will post.

    The random prize is a whole easier on the pocket book. You can give away what ever you want, whether its a $5 gift, or a $20 gist - its called random for a reason.
